About this website:

The website content provided seems to be a mix of generic phrases often found on scam or low-quality websites. Here are some reasons why this website might be considered a scam: Lack of Detailed Information: Legitimate travel websites typically provide comprehensive information about their services, including details about the hotels they work with, the booking process, and their company background. The content you provided lacks this kind of detailed information. Unprofessional Design: The use of generic phrases, repetitive content, and a lack of clear structure can be indicators of an unprofessional or hastily created website, which is often associated with scam sites. Unrealistic Earning Claims: The mention of earning percentages for different levels of travelers (e.g., novice, backpacker, business, global) is not a standard practice for legitimate travel booking websites. It's unusual for users to earn money based on their traveler level. Copyright Date: The mention of a copyright date of 2023 on the website, especially if the current year is 2021, can be a red flag. It may indicate that the site is trying to appear more established than it actually is. Repetitive Content: The repetition of hotel names and phrases in the content you provided is not typical of professional, high-quality websites. It can be a sign of low effort or automated content generation, which is often associated with scam sites. Lack of Secure Login: If the website prompts users to log in without providing a secure connection (HTTPS), it can be a security risk. Legitimate websites, especially those handling sensitive information like login credentials, should use secure connections. Hidden Domain Whois Information: The fact that the domain whois information is hidden can be a red flag. Legitimate websites typically have transparent domain registration information, and hidden details can be associated with fraudulent or suspicious activities. New Domain Age: A domain that is only 5 days old can be a significant red flag. While not all new websites are scams, a very new domain should be approached with caution, especially if other red flags are present. In summary, based on the content and the information provided, the website appears to have several characteristics commonly associated with scam or low-quality websites. It's important to exercise caution and consider these red flags before engaging with the site or providing any personal or financial information."
